Grayscale’s ETF Sees Lowest Bitcoin Withdrawals

Grayscale Bitcoin Trust, now operating as a spot Bitcoin ETF, reported its lowest daily withdrawal level on Wednesday since its transition in January. This marked decrease to just $17.5 million worth of BTC sold, compared to the high rates of over $150 million in the preceding days, has ignited optimism among investors and observers. The […]

Surge in Crypto Fund Inflows Hits New High

In a remarkable week for cryptocurrency investment, funds under the stewardship of leading asset managers like BlackRock, Bitwise, Fidelity, Grayscale, ProShares, and 21Shares have witnessed an impressive influx of $646 million globally, as detailed in the latest report by CoinShares. This financial injection comes on the heels of an already substantial $862 million inflow from […]

Grayscale’s ETF: A Rough Patch?

Grayscale’s Bitcoin spot ETF fund is experiencing turbulent times, with investors rapidly withdrawing their stakes amidst a flurry of activity towards competing funds. Since its shift to a spot Bitcoin ETF in January, the fund has seen an unprecedented outflow, surpassing $15 billion to date, marking the largest withdrawal any ETF has faced since March […]
